$650,000 taken from Iraqi embassy
SANAA, Yemen: Yemeni authorities investigated the disappearance of $650,000 from the safe of the Iraqi embassy in the the capital of Sanaa, it was reported Monday. The weekly magazine al-Naas quoted sources as saying at least three embassy employees were interrogated by security forces.
